Lufttransport awarded North Sea SAR contract
Lufttransport has been awarded a contract by energy firm Equinor to provide search and rescue (SAR) helicopter services in the North Sea
The five-year contract will see Lufttransport use two Leonardo AW139 helicopters to provide SAR services in Norway’s Troll and Oseberg offshore oil and gas fields, beginning in early 2026.
One of the helicopters will be stationed at the Oseberg Field Centre, while the other will serve as a backup, and will be stationed at a heliport in Flesland.
The new helicopters will supplement the work of two Sikorsky S-92s that currently conduct SAR operations in the area.
While the initial term will see Lufttransport fly the AW139s until at least 2031, the contract includes an option for five one-year extensions – offering the potential for the service to be maintained until 2036.
